This is a super quick post. Nona Jones (Head of faith partnerships at Facebook) just announced that Facebook is working on new functionality that will allow people to dial into Facebook live.

As it is in beta, I understand it it will only be available for 200 churches based in the US for this Easter weekend.

WHAT IT IS

Adding a dial-in number will make it possible for people who do not have web or mobile data access to listen to your live broadcast from any telephone. There is a phone number and access code that people will need to dial. NOTE: This feature is currently limited to live video (either true live or scheduled live) and cannot be used with Premier.

If your application is approved, you will be able to enable a call-in number and create a new access code when setting up a Live or scheduled Live broadcast in order to secure it up to 7 days before your broadcast. The feature is not available for broadcasts originating from a mobile phone and cannot be enabled for broadcasts with audience restrictions (age or geographic restrictions).

It will be up to you to promote the existence of the phone number and access code to your audience. The phone number will not appear on Facebook automatically during the broadcast. All calls are muted and cannot be un-muted, listeners cannot be heard. IMPORTANT: Numbers will not be toll free in this initial test.
